An example of multiple alleles is the ABO blood-type system in humans. In this case, the IA and IB alleles are codominant with each other and are both dominant over the i allele. Although there are three alleles present in a population, each individual only gets two of the alleles from their parents.

How many alleles are there for human blood type?
The four main blood groups A, B, AB, and O are controlled by three alleles: A, B, and O. As humans are diploid, only two of these can be present in any one genotype.
What is an example of a multiple allele?
Two human examples of multiple-allele genes are the gene of the ABO blood group system, and the human-leukocyte-associated antigen (HLA) genes. The ABO system in humans is controlled by three alleles, usually referred to as IA, IB, and IO (the “I” stands for isohaemagglutinin).
Is multiple allele common in human?
Traits controlled by more than two alleles have multiple alleles. Although any one person usually has only two alleles for a gene, more than two alleles can exist in the population’s gene pool. In fact, within the human population, it may be safe to say that most human genes have more than two alleles.
Why is human blood type an example of Codominance and multiple alleles?
Codominance means that neither allele can mask the expression of the other allele. An example in humans would be the ABO blood group, where alleles A and alleles B are both expressed. So if an individual inherits allele A from their mother and allele B from their father, they have blood type AB.

What are the three alleles for blood type?
Human blood type is determined by codominant alleles. There are three different alleles, known as I A, I B, and i. The I A and I B alleles are codominant, and the i allele is recessive.
